No preview for Word file available - why?

I don't work with Word files very often, so this might be a newbe question. When I worked with Word files in the past, I could always get an HTML and a Word preview. The file I am currently working with was exported from Teams and contains comments - can that break the preview functionality?

    The issue you're experiencing with the preview functionality in Trados Studio when working with Word files exported from Teams might be due to the presence of comments or track changes in the document. This is a known issue and a defect has been raised for this situation, with ID CRQ-30284.

    Here are some steps you can take to try and resolve this issue:

    Step 1: Try to remove all comments and track changes from the Word document before importing it into Trados Studio. This can be done in Word by going to the "Review" tab, selecting "Next" in the "Changes" group to navigate to the first tracked change or comment, and then selecting "Accept" or "Reject" to remove the change. Repeat this process until all changes and comments have been removed.

    Step 2: If the issue persists, try to save the Word document in a different format, such as .doc instead of .docx, and then import this file into Trados Studio.

    Step 3: If none of the above steps work, you might have to wait for the defect to be resolved in a future update of Trados Studio.

    Please note that these are just potential solutions and might not work in all cases. The definitive solution will come with the resolution of the defect.
